Fri Mar 14 2014 | 09:55 | Lorenzo Brown loses his spot to Johnson-Odom |
76ers will release G Lorenzo Brown. |
Brown, who is battling a sore foot, loses his roster spot to Darius Johnson-Odom. Brown appeared in 26 games for Tankadelphia this season, averaging 2.5 points and 1.6 assists in 8.6 minutes a night. |

Mon Feb 24 2014 | 18:10 | Lorenzo Brown has torn ligaments in wrist |
Lorenzo Brown has torn ligaments in his right wrist and is out indefinitely. |
He won't need surgery, but said it "hurt like hell" when he played. This news explains why Eric Maynor is the new backup point guard. Neither player has fantasy value. |

Mon Jan 27 2014 | 10:51 | 76ers assign Lorenzo Brown to D-Legue |
The 76ers have assigned PG Lorenzo Brown to the D-League. |
He has filled a useful role when injuries strike the Sixers' backcourt, but with Michael Carter-Williams healthy and Tony Wroten (ankle) recently returned to the lineup, it makes sense for Brown to get some playing time with the Delaware 87ers. |

Wed Nov 20 2013 | 18:12 | Sixers add Lorenzo Brown for Wednesday |
The Sixers signed Lorenzo Brown and he will be available for Wednesday's game. |
He was drafted at 52 out of NC State by the Timberwolves and the shallow Sixers roster will give him a chance to show what he can do. Brown has no fantasy value. |
